Femoral component positioning in resurfacing arthroplasty--effects on cortical strains.

2009 
: Previous studies have suggested that femoral component positioning in resurfacing arthroplasty may affect strains in the femoral neck that could lead to decreased implant longevity. A strain gaged, Sawbones model was used to determine the femoral neck strains for a variety of resurfacing head translations and angulations. We found that head positions affected strain distributions, most positions leading to increased neck strains, often over 100%, with the exception being a varus head position where the superior neck strains decreased over 50%. Although the clinical meaning of these findings is unclear, it could be of concern for stress-shielding or fatigue fracture of the femoral neck.
